I am a student intern working for the Neighborhood Housing Partnership in Cambridge, MA, whose director, Polly Allen, is the prime organizer of the Erie Street Neighbors' Association. Polly will be participating in the 4th World Conference on Women in Beijing, China this coming August, as a grassroots organizer. She is gathering information to compile an Exchange Booklet about cohousing in existing urban neighborhoods(Virtual CoHo). This booklet will function as a way to exchange information about how people from all over the world are creating domestic support systems around them for individuals and families. We seek examples of urban inter-household cooperative networks with innovative spacial programs to support common life(e.g. Erie Street).
